The Watertower Lauwerhof is a stunning historical landmark that stands proudly in the heart of Utrecht, surrounded by a charming neighborhood filled with quaint streets and delightful cafes. Originally built to serve as a water supply tower, this architectural gem is a fine example of late 19th-century design, showcasing intricate brickwork and elegant proportions that appeal to both history enthusiasts and casual visitors alike. As you approach the tower, you will be captivated by its striking silhouette against the urban backdrop, making it a perfect subject for photography or a peaceful moment of contemplation.The surrounding area enhances the experience, with lush greenery and serene parks that invite you to take a leisurely stroll or enjoy a relaxing picnic. The Watertower Lauwerhof not only represents Utrecht's historical significance but also reflects the city's commitment to preserving its cultural heritage.
